Course details
In this course, David Morales, a web developer and technical instructor, gives you the tools and knowledge that you need to start developing with the Ruby on Rails web framework, using a GitHub Codespaces environment. Get an overview of the development environment, then create a simple application. Learn how to work with databases, migrations, routes, controllers, and the asset pipeline. Plus, go over image management with Active Storage, code reuse techniques, and using Hotwire to add reactivity without writing JavaScript.
The best way to learn a language is to use it in practice. That’s why this course is integrated with GitHub Codespaces, an instant cloud developer environment that offers all the functionality of your favorite IDE without the need for any local machine setup. With GitHub Codespaces, you can get hands-on practice from any machine, at any time—all while using a tool that you’ll likely encounter in the workplace. Check out the “Using GitHub Codespaces with this course” video to learn how to get started.
